Locked out

It can be a nightmare to be locked out of your vehicle. These situations are mostly unavoidable however, you can reduce the chance of them occurring.

Plan ahead. Signing up for an app account with your automaker, subscribing roadside assistance or leaving a spare key fob with the home of a trusted family member or friend could all help you avoid an emergency lockout.

If you're unable to apply the preventive techniques or if your DIY attempts have not worked, it's best to call a professional car locksmith near me. They are available 24 hours a day and can unlock your vehicle without damaging it. A list of their numbers will save you money, time and stress in the future.

Some car owners find that their roadside assistance plan could be of assistance in case of lockout. These insurances are often able to aid you in accessing your vehicle by using tools such as a Slim Jim or another automotive tool, or they may be able to unlock your door manually. If you're an AAA member, for instance the service is included in your membership.

In certain situations, you simply cannot wait for a locksmith to arrive or attempt to jimmy open the door. This is especially true if there are children or pets trapped inside the vehicle. In this situation, you may want to call the police. They are often able to enter the vehicle quicker and more securely than you are able to with makeshift tools like shoeslaces, a doorstop or a coat hanger made of wire.

Lost Car Keys

It is frustrating to lose your car key locksmiths keys. However, it's not the end of the world You must follow a few simple steps to replace them as swiftly and as easily as you can. First, it's recommended to contact the local police station. It's worth calling to determine if they have your keys.

After that, you should conduct a thorough inspection of your home. It may sound silly but many people don't know where their keys are. It is essential to search all possible hiding places. Examine your backpack or handbag and any compartments or pockets and the inside of doors and windows. You can also look in your car's trunk or under your seat. If you have a spare key, you could use it to return to the road.

If you have a conventional key, you can typically find a locksmith that can create an entirely new key for you right on the spot. If, however, your vehicle has a more technologically advanced key fob or key, you may need to be towed to the dealership to have a replacement key programmed. They will need to know your vehicle's make and model as well as proof that you own the vehicle - such as the registration or a title.

You can sometimes buy discounted replacement keys or key fobs online but you should be sure to do some research about what the costs might be for locksmiths who cut and program them. Contact your locksmith for a generic key that they can program to match your car. This will reduce your expenses and avoid the need to go to the dealership. Ignition Replacement

Over time, the ignition switch can wear out. This happens when it receives lots of usage, which is normal for most automobiles. If your ignition is damaged it may not start the car or not even start at all. There are many ways to fix the problem. One option is to contact an emergency locksmiths for cars near me, since they can help you with this problem. They will be able to identify the issue and advise you if the ignition needs to be replaced. They can also replace your key if necessary.

It can be difficult to repair the ignition yourself since you must remove parts that could disrupt the airbag system. Always consult the repair manual for your vehicle before beginning. It is also recommended to disconnect the negative battery cable from your vehicle prior to beginning the process.

Getting your key stuck in the ignition can cause serious damage if not cautious. You may cause more harm than good by trying to force the key out or jiggle it using tweezers. The best solution is to call an expert who can open your car without doing any harm to the ignition or other parts of the vehicle.

A local emergency locksmith has all the tools and equipment necessary to get your vehicle running again. They will be able tell you whether the ignition cylinder, or the key needs to be changed. In the majority of instances, they'll be in a position to replace the ignition cylinder without replacing the key. They may have to cut you a new key if your vehicle has anti-theft security.

To begin the ignition replacement process, you will need to remove the cover of the steering column and dash panels. This can be an unpleasant task so be patient and clean up any wires or components you expose. Then, remove the screw that is holding the cover of the ignition lock housing. Once that is done you will be able to access the ignition cylinder and switch. Then, you can replace the cylinder and switch according to the instructions provided in your vehicle's service manual.

Broken Key Extraction

It can be difficult to get rid of the broken piece of your key if it breaks inside the lock. The force of a blow can cause further damage and push the damaged piece deeper into the lock. Instead try to relax and use different tools to help pull it out.

First, ensure that you apply the lubricant. This will make it easier to remove the key. You can buy spray bottles of the stuff at most hardware stores. After you've applied it, align the lock in either a locked or unlocked position, based on the location of the break. You may need to try different positions until you are able to retrieve the broken piece.

If a decent part of the broken key is sticking out, try using needle-nose pliers or tweezers to grasp it and pull it out. However, it is important that the tweezers or pliers fit inside the lock without pushing the broken piece further into. Make sure they are thin enough to grab the broken piece and grip it.

A professional locksmith may make use of a tool called a key extractor to remove a broken part of the lock. These are thin strips of metal with grooves in their surface. They can be bent into a hook to grab a broken piece of a key.

Key extractors can come in various shapes, but they all have the same purpose. Once you have your tool, you can insert it into the lock and turn it around a bit. The sharp prongs will grasp onto the broken piece of the key and gradually pull it out.

If you do not have a key extractor that is professional, you can use a screw from your toolbox. You'll need a small screw that's thin enough to fit into the lock and that has a hook attached to it. Start by aligning the screw in a locked or unlocked position. Once the screw is in place, you can begin to twist it at different angles against the key and plug.
